911 Transcript from Lamibogish 26-8-07
A transcription of an emergency call from a town that no longer exists
Unknown Caller
October 26, 2007
911 Operator: 911, what is your emergency?
Caller: [sounds to be a young girl] Hello?
Operator: What is your emergency?
Caller: I…I had a bad dream.
Operator: Okay, my dear, 9-1-1 is for emergencies only, like when people are hurt or in a lot of trouble. Can you hang up and talk to your parents?
Caller: They took my parents.
Operator: They took your parents? Can you tell me more about what’s happening, my dear?
Caller: I had a bad dream and I woke up to tell Mommy and Daddy about it. I went to their bedroom, but I heard Daddy crying. I looked inside their room and saw Daddy on the floor next to Mommy. She was on the ground and wasn’t moving. There was a lot of blood around her.
Operator: So your Mommy is hurt. We can send an ambulance for her. What’s your address?
Caller: And there was a man standing behind Daddy. I could only see his smile.
Operator: We can send police too. Are you in a safe spot in the house, my dear?
Caller: I’m under my bed.
Operator: All right, stay there and try not to make too much noise. Where is your house, my dear?
[A door sliding open sounds on the caller’s end]
Caller: [barely audible] I shouldn’t talk; he’s here. He’s coming out of my closet.
[Rhythmic footsteps are captured on the caller’s end. The caller breathes heavily, then starts screaming. A male voice is heard in the background, singing.]
